Our Vision
For children and youth to reach their fullest potential in school and life

Our Mission
To help children and youth succeed by strengthening and expanding quality in the out-of-school time field

Prime Time Palm Beach County is a nonprofit intermediary organization that serves out-of-school time (OST) programs and practitioners. We provide supports and resources that increase program quality to positively impact school-age youth. Prime Time provides a set of quality standards, a system for reaching these standards through assessment, technical assistance and resources, as well as a broad and diverse range of program enhancements to afterschool providers. We also offer a set of core competencies, professional development opportunities, and networking events for OST professionals across the county.
